Transaction 7d1e360f256d61a1b3b48b78f1ce61c46e4c62bd5ef63574929ff01fe8719f6e
1 Input
1 Outputs
- 7d1e360f256d61a1b3b48b78f1ce61c46e4c62bd5ef63574929ff01fe8719f6e:0
value 698378
address 31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z